Saint Mary's College (Saint Lucia)

Saint Mary's College is an all-male secondary school located in Vigie, Castries, Saint Lucia.

Saint Mary's College opened on 20 April 1890, founded by Rev.

Louis Tapon as the first secondary school in Saint Lucia.

[1] [2] In 2022 there was a legal case after the head sent a student home because he had a full head of hair.

Judge Kimberly Cenac-Phulgence granted an injunction obliging the school to admit the student while the dispute was settled.
